美文网首页flutter
08.3 Dart 箭头函数 函数的相互调用

08.3 Dart 箭头函数 函数的相互调用

作者: __Mr_Xie__ | 来源:发表于2023-03-05 08:52 被阅读0次
void main(){
/*需求:使用forEach打印下面List里面的数据*/
    // List list=['苹果','香蕉','西瓜'];

    // list.forEach((value){
    //   print(value);
    // });

    // list.forEach((value)=>print(value));

    // list.forEach((value)=>{
    //   print(value)
    // });

/*需求:修改下面List里面的数据,让数组中大于2的值乘以2*/

    List list=[4,1,2,3,4];

    // var newList=list.map((value){

    //     if(value>2){
    //       return value*2;
    //     }
    //     return value;

    // });
    // print(newList.toList());

  //  var newList=list.map((value)=>value>2?value*2:value);

  //  print(newList.toList());

/*
需求:    1、定义一个方法isEvenNumber来判断一个数是否是偶数  
         2、定义一个方法打印1-n以内的所有偶数
*/

//定义一个方法isEvenNumber来判断一个数是否是偶数  
    bool isEvenNumber(int n){
      if(n%2==0){
        return true;
      }
      return false;
    }

    printNum(int n){
        for(var i=1;i<=n;i++){
            if(isEvenNumber(i)){
              print(i);
            }
        }
    }

    printNum(10);
}

相关文章

  • 【Dart】函数

    声明函数 直接声明Dart中声明函数不需要function关键字 箭头函数+Dart中 的箭头函数中,函数体只能写...

  • TS  笔记this

    this 箭头函数在箭头函数创建的地方获得this;非箭头函数,在调用函数的地方获得this如图

  • js 父子组件函数相互调用

    父子组件相互调用函数 在父子组件内的都得使用箭头函数 省略写法 ()=>this.action() || th...

  • 改变this指向的方法

    箭头函数和普通函数的区别如下。 普通函数:根据调用我的人(谁调用我,我的this就指向谁) 箭头函数:根据所在的环...

  • JS 函数

    函数的定义 具名函数 匿名函数 箭头函数 构造函数 调用时机 先赋值后调用 先调用后赋值 setTimeout 作...

  • js函数和原型对象

    函数提升(Hoisting):函数可以在声明之前调用 自调用函数、函数声明、函数表达式、匿名函数、箭头函数: 自调...

  • 箭头函数和普通函数的区别

    定义 变量提升 由于 js 的内存机制,箭头函数需要先定义后调用 构造函数 箭头函数作为匿名函数,不能作为构造函数...

  • JavaScript 函数

    函数函数定义与调用变量作用域全局变量方法高阶函数闭包箭头函数$generator$ 函数 函数定义与调用 定义函数...

  • js函数

    定义函数 具名函数 匿名函数 注意fn2()作用域为 = 右侧 箭头函数 在调用箭头函数时里面的this就是外面的...

  • promise async/await

    箭头函数 普通函数 简写 就是 箭头函数 正文 当有多个接口需要顺序调用时顺序调用是指 :接口1返回的数据 ,作为...

网友评论

    本文标题:08.3 Dart 箭头函数 函数的相互调用

    本文链接:https://www.haomeiwen.com/subject/vulykdtx.html